Twin Peaks Rewatch

Twin Peaks Rewatch 23: Slaves and Masters



It's been a rough journey back through Twin Peaks recently, but we think we may have hit the roughest patch, with clearer skies to come. For now, we remain confounded—join us as we stumble through the highs and lows of "Slaves and Masters."